Mediterranean Flatbread Pizza Recipe
Introduction
Enjoy the vibrant flavors of the Mediterranean with this easy flatbread pizza recipe. It’s quick to prepare, packed with fresh veggies, and topped with a delicious spinach pesto base. Perfect for a light dinner or a flavorful snack.

Ingredients
- 2 flatbread crusts (homemade or storebought)
- 2 tablespoons olive oil
- 1/2 cup spinach pesto
- 8 oz. shredded mozzarella
- 1 cup halved grape tomatoes
- 1/2 cup thinly sliced red onion
- 2.25 oz. can sliced black olives
- 1 cup quartered artichoke hearts
- 1/2 cup crumbled feta
- 1 teaspoon dried oregano
- Kosher salt, to taste
- Garnish: fresh chopped parsley
- Garnish: fresh arugula leaves
Instructions
- Step 1: Preheat your oven to 500 degrees Fahrenheit. If making flatbread from scratch, prepare and par-bake according to your recipe, or simply use store-bought flatbread crusts.
- Step 2: Brush both flatbread crusts evenly with olive oil to add flavor and crispiness.
- Step 3: Spread the spinach pesto evenly over each crust, creating a flavorful base layer.
- Step 4: Sprinkle the shredded mozzarella evenly on top of the pesto on both crusts.
- Step 5: Distribute the halved grape tomatoes, thinly sliced red onion, sliced black olives, quartered artichoke hearts, crumbled feta, and dried oregano evenly over each pizza. Add a pinch of kosher salt to taste.
- Step 6: Bake the pizzas in the preheated oven for 5 to 10 minutes, or until the vegetables are tender and the cheese is melted and bubbly.
- Step 7: Remove from the oven and garnish with fresh chopped parsley and arugula leaves before serving. Enjoy your Mediterranean flatbread pizza!
Tips & Variations
- For extra flavor, sprinkle some crushed red pepper flakes before baking for a mild kick.
- Try swapping the spinach pesto for a classic basil pesto or sun-dried tomato pesto.
- Add grilled chicken or roasted chickpeas for added protein.
- If you prefer a crispier crust, bake the flatbread a few minutes longer before adding toppings.
Storage
You can store leftover flatbread pizza in an airtight container in the refrigerator for up to 3 days. To reheat, bake in a 350-degree oven for 5-7 minutes or until warmed through to keep the crust crispy. Avoid microwaving to prevent sogginess.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use regular pizza dough instead of flatbread crust?
Yes, you can use pizza dough as a base, but baking times may vary. Par-bake the dough first to ensure it cooks through before adding the toppings.
Is spinach pesto easy to make at home?
Absolutely! Spinach pesto is simple to prepare by blending fresh spinach, garlic, nuts (like pine nuts or walnuts), Parmesan cheese, olive oil, and a squeeze of lemon juice. It’s a fresh and healthy alternative to traditional basil pesto.
PrintMediterranean Flatbread Pizza Recipe
This Mediterranean Flatbread Pizza is a vibrant, flavorful twist on traditional pizza featuring nutritious toppings like spinach pesto, artichoke hearts, sundry olives, and fresh vegetables, baked on crispy flatbread crusts. Perfect for a quick and healthy meal, this pizza offers a delightful Mediterranean flair with the creamy mozzarella and tangy feta cheese complementing fresh tomatoes and aromatic herbs.
- Prep Time: 10 minutes
- Cook Time: 5-10 minutes
- Total Time: 15-20 minutes
- Yield: 2 flatbread pizzas, serves 4 1x
- Category: Pizza
- Method: Baking
- Cuisine: Mediterranean
Ingredients
Flatbread Base
- 2 flatbread crusts (homemade or storebought)
- 2 tablespoons olive oil
Toppings
- 1/2 cup spinach pesto
- 8 oz. shredded mozzarella
- 1 cup halved grape tomatoes
- 1/2 cup thinly sliced red onion
- 2.25 oz. can sliced black olives
- 1 cup quartered artichoke hearts
- 1/2 cup crumbled feta
- 1 teaspoon dried oregano
- Kosher salt, to taste
Garnish
- Fresh chopped parsley
- Fresh arugula leaves
Instructions
- Preheat Oven: Preheat your oven to 500 degrees Fahrenheit to ensure it is hot enough to create a crispy crust and melt the cheese properly.
- Prepare Flatbread Crusts: If using homemade flatbread, prepare and par-bake according to your recipe instructions. Alternatively, use two store-bought flatbread crusts for convenience.
- Brush with Olive Oil: Lightly brush both flatbread crusts with olive oil to add flavor and help them crisp up during baking.
- Spread Pesto: Evenly divide 1/2 cup spinach pesto between the two crusts, spreading a smooth, even layer over each crust to infuse a fresh, herby flavor.
- Add Cheese: Sprinkle the shredded mozzarella evenly over the pesto on both flatbreads. This cheese will melt beautifully to bind the toppings.
- Layer Vegetables and Olives: Top each flatbread with halved grape tomatoes, thinly sliced red onions, sliced black olives, quartered artichoke hearts, and crumbled feta cheese. Add dried oregano and a pinch of kosher salt to enhance the Mediterranean flavors.
- Bake: Place the topped flatbreads on a baking sheet and bake them in the preheated oven for 5-10 minutes, or until the vegetables are tender and the cheese is fully melted and bubbly.
- Garnish and Serve: Remove from the oven, garnish with fresh chopped parsley and fresh arugula leaves for a peppery, fresh finish. Slice and serve immediately for the best flavor and texture.
Notes
- You can customize the toppings with your favorite Mediterranean vegetables like roasted red peppers or sun-dried tomatoes.
- For a crispier crust, bake directly on an oven rack or use a pizza stone if available.
- Use gluten-free flatbread crusts to make this recipe gluten-free.
- If you prefer a vegan version, substitute mozzarella and feta with plant-based cheeses, and ensure pesto is dairy-free.
- Store any leftovers wrapped tightly in the fridge and reheat in the oven to retain crispiness.
Keywords: Mediterranean flatbread pizza, spinach pesto pizza, quick flatbread recipe, healthy pizza, vegetarian pizza, artichoke pizza

